A cold front is expected to bring widespread showers and thunderstorms to north Alabama starting mid-week, with rain chances increasing from Monday-Tuesday (low) to Wednesday-Friday (higher), and temperatures moderating from the 80s to upper 70s-low 80s; this rainfall may help alleviate the current drought, with 2-3 inches expected by the first half of next weekend.

Everyone at WAVY 10, Storm Tracker, Chief Meteorologist Jeff Castle. Hope you enjoyed the weekend. Today ended up being the hottest day of the year so far. A lot of us saw 90 for the first time here in 2026. We're going to be close again on Monday before some changes do arrive around the middle of next week. We're still expecting our next cold front to begin pushing into the area and it's not necessarily going to come and go and completely clear things out. So, showers and thunderstorms will return on kind of a widespread scale and then they're likely to hang with us on a daily basis for the remainder of next week and likely into that Memorial Day holiday weekend. We will pick up some summer downpours out of this, but right now does not necessarily look like we're going to be set up for severe weather threats. We'll keep an eye on that for you and let you know if it changes. Here's a breakdown of those rain chances for the week ahead. Monday, Tuesday they stay fairly low, but won't rule out something isolated. Wednesday, Thursday, Friday though starting to pick up the pace on the wet weather. Do expect to see scattered showers and thunderstorms somewhere in the area every day starting then and likely continuing again into that holiday weekend. Here's that rainfall forecast. Next 7 days this will take us through next Saturday and the numbers are good here. You know, we've made some progress denting the drought in the last few weeks. I know we've had a bit of a dry stretch here over the last week or so, but we are going to pick the rain back up maybe to the tune of 2 to 3 inches between now and the first half of next weekend and again that would go a long way to continue and alleviate the ongoing drought situation for us. So, we take into your Monday though rain will be a little tough to find, but not out of the question.
Overnight tonight we do expect just partly cloudy skies. Temperatures will fall back into the mid-60s. Through the day tomorrow we're going to heat up pretty quickly again. Mix of clouds and sun already into the mid-80s around the lunch hour and we'll be flirting with 90° again tomorrow afternoon. Most of the afternoon spent in the upper 80s, but we may briefly touch that 90° mark.
We once again see some showers close to the Georgia border. We might sneak one or two of those into Jackson, DeKalb County, but right now not expecting anything more significant than that for your Monday. Similar situation on Tuesday, just a 10% chance for any rainfall. Highs will be in the upper 80s. We pick up the rain chances, and we dial back the temperatures for the second half of the week. Upper 70s, low 80s for your highs. Morning lows will be high end of the 60s. And again, we will pick up a daily chance for showers and thunderstorms. And right now we do expect that'll likely continue through the holiday weekend, probably beyond as well, as at least for now, doesn't look like we're going to get a chance to completely dry things out. So, hopefully you know where the rain gear is. It's something that you'll likely get some frequent use out of starting around the middle of next week.
